A Senior Associate role in the corporate sector represents a pivotal and advanced career stage, often serving as the crucial bridge between upper management and operational teams. Professionals in these jobs are recognized as subject matter experts and trusted leaders who drive key business functions, manage significant client portfolios or internal projects, and contribute directly to strategic growth. While the specific domain varies—encompassing fields like finance, law, consulting, real estate, and technology—the core of the position revolves around high-level responsibility, autonomous decision-making, and mentorship. Typically, individuals in Senior Associate jobs are entrusted with overseeing the end-to-end delivery of major services or projects. Common responsibilities include leading client engagements and serving as the primary senior point of contact, shaping project strategy and ensuring commercial objectives are met. They manage budgets, timelines, and resources for complex assignments, often with substantial financial value. A significant part of the role involves quality control, rigorous reporting, and contract or risk management. Furthermore, Senior Associates almost always have a people leadership component, which includes mentoring junior staff, guiding their professional development, and fostering a high-performance team culture. They are also expected to contribute to business development through writing proposals, nurturing client relationships, and identifying new opportunities. The typical skills and requirements for these corporate jobs are demanding, reflecting the seniority of the position. A relevant undergraduate degree is a standard prerequisite, often supplemented by advanced professional qualifications such as an MBA, CPA, JD, or chartered status (e.g., MRICS, CFA). Most roles require a substantial track record of 6-10+ years of progressive experience within a specific industry or consultancy environment. Essential skills extend beyond technical expertise to include exceptional commercial and financial acumen, advanced client relationship management, and persuasive communication abilities for interfacing with executives and stakeholders. Strong leadership, project management, and the ability to work independently on complex problems are fundamental. Successful Senior Associates demonstrate strategic thinking, a solutions-oriented mindset, and a proven capacity to manage both projects and people effectively. Ultimately, Senior Associate jobs are designed for seasoned professionals ready to assume greater commercial leadership and accountability. These roles offer a clear pathway to director-level and executive positions, providing a platform to influence business direction, drive profitability, and leave a lasting impact on both their organization and the development of their teams.
